Webb20 okt. 2015 · Nagapushpa is the Sanskrit word for Mesua ferrea tree (Nagakesara in Telugu language). It is also called Ceylon ironwood, Indian rose chestnut or Cobra’s saffron. Mesua ferrea (Nagapushpa tree) is a slow-growing tree named after the heaviness and hardness of its timber. It is cultivated for decorative purpose because of its graceful …
